Rights … WebPennsylvania Consolidated Statutes Section 6110.1 - Possession of firearm by minor. § 6110.1. Possession of firearm by minor. (a) Firearm.--Except as provided in subsection (b), a person under 18 years of age shall not possess or transport a firearm anywhere in this Commonwealth. Possession of firearm with altered manufacturer's number. (a) General rule.-- No person shall possess a firearm which has had the manufacturer's number integral to the frame or receiver altered, changed, removed or obliterated.
